Thomas Charles CREASEY

Regimental number2396
Place of birthHorsham, Victoria
ReligionPresbyterian
OccupationFarm hand
AddressHorsham, Victoria
Marital statusSingle
Age at embarkation21
Next of kinFather, Charles Creasey, Horsham, Victoria
Enlistment date10 May 1916
Place of enlistmentMelbourne, Victoria
Rank on enlistmentPrivate
Unit name46th Battalion, 5th Reinforcement
AWM Embarkation Roll number23/63/4
Embarkation detailsUnit embarked from Melbourne, Victoria, on board HMAT A15 Port Sydney on 7 September 1916
Miscellaneous details (Nominal Roll)Name does not appear on Nominal Roll
Miscellaneous information from
  cemetery records
Commemorated on Green Park Presbyterian Sunday School Honor Roll, Horsham Historical Society. Plaque in Victorian Garden of Remembrance.
Family/military connectionsBrother: 2395 Pte Joseph William Charles CREASEY, 46th Bn,
Other details

War service: Western Front

Medals: British War Medal, Victory Medal
Date of death8 June 1959
